Definitions:

Foreign Prices

The cost or value of goods and services from a country different from the domestic market, often influenced by currency exchange rates.

Real Exchange Rate

The rate at which a person can trade the goods and services of one country for the goods and services of another, adjusted for inflation.

Purchasing-power Parity

a theory that in the long run, exchange rates ought to adjust so that an identical good in different countries will have the same price when expressed in a common currency.

Nominal Exchange Rate

The rate at which one country's currency can be exchanged for another country's currency without adjusting for inflation.
